    last year we did death valley... i have here in my hand a big bag of sand from artoos dunes at stovepipe wells,and some awesome photos from the road to jabbas palace,which was mindblowing...even my wife was stunned by how instantly recognisable it is,nearly thirty years later...the dantes view overlook,aka mos eisley overlook is a heart-pounding walk along a ridge but an awesome view once there! the same for the tusken raider canyon where they shot the elephant as the bantha... we never found the trail that artoo pootles along but may have driven past it,without realising,lol.
    death valley was simply awesome,
